Output 51d1a5f4b627fa74713f200bb114a2cccbdb70fe2af0be52dac5bdbf7a1b3a88:0

value
52970794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 770437d7111196347ea903a316eb84e59c461060 OP_EQUAL
address
3CYKPTAzyg3VnRtTuBJvRKtP3HYL48fPJo
transaction
51d1a5f4b627fa74713f200bb114a2cccbdb70fe2af0be52dac5bdbf7a1b3a88
spent
true